摘要
A variational enhancement method for infrared images was proposed based on total variation (TV) and contrast. Considering that the infrared images generally are much noisy, the proposed method restricts the noise to compute the target gradient based on the existing variational enhancement scheme. In addition, the object function includes an extra term representing total variations, which gives a further suppression to the noise. The histogram-based algorithms are likely to merge the gray levels which are similar in intensity and have low distribution, thus some useful details will be decreased. The proposed variational method does not have such problems as histogram method, and is more effective to enhance infrared images.
